Mark Strand (1934–2014) was a Canadian-born American poet. He won the Pulitzer Prize for Blizzard of One.
Poet’s Sampler: Mark Strand
Over a long and distinguished career, with honors that include a Pulitzer Prize and the U.S. Poet Laureateship, Mark Strand has compiled a body of poems that display a remarkable unity of vision and variety of content.
